TS Inter Result Pass Percentage & Analysis 2025 - The Telangana Board of Intermediate Education has announced Class 11 and 12 board exam results on April 22, 2025, at 12 pm. Along with the TSBIE result 2025 announcement, the board has revealed the TS inter result pass percentage and statistics 2025. These are important components to analyse the board and student performance over the years.
Every year, around 10 lakh students appear for the 1st and 2nd year TS inter exams and the TSBIE pass percentage stands between 60-75%. Check out the TS inter result pass percentage and statistics 2025 in this article.
The overall pass percentage of TS 2nd year is 4.48% higher than TS 1st year. The 2nd year pass percentage has remained higher than the 1st year in the previous 3 years, including this year. This year, overall of 997012 students appeared in the TS inter 1st and 2nd year examinations. Out of which, 508582 students appeared for the TSBIE 2nd year exam and 488430 for the TS inter 1st year examination.
